Comparing Costs: Free versus Paid Events
When planning your holiday activities, one important factor to consider is cost. While some events are free, others come with a price tag. Let’s take a closer look at the costs associated with participating in free versus paid events.
Free Events
Free events are a great way to enjoy the holiday spirit without breaking the bank. Some popular free events include:
- Festive parades and holiday lights displays (free admission, but donations may be encouraged)
- Visiting Santa’s workshop or petting zoo (free, but some may charge for photos or activities)
- Walking through festive markets or holiday tree lots (free admission, but you may want to purchase goods or drinks)
- Attending free outdoor concerts or performances (often held in public spaces, such as parks or plazas)
- Participating in holiday-themed scavenger hunts or treasure hunts (free, but may require registration or RSVP)
Cost of Paid Events
While free events are a great way to save money, some activities come with a price tag. Paid events can include:
- Ticketed holiday concerts or performances ( prices vary, but often $10-$50 per person)
- Special holiday events or festivals (entry fees range from $5-$20 per person)
- Horse-drawn carriage rides or sleigh rides (prices vary, but often $50-$100 per family)
- Ice skating or snow tubing (rental fees may apply, ranging from $10-$50 per person)
- Private holiday workshops or classes (prices vary, but often $20-$100 per person)
In conclusion, while free events can be a cost-effective way to enjoy the holiday spirit, some activities may require a small investment. Be sure to research and plan ahead to make the most of your holiday activities.

Navigating Ticket Sales and Reserve Seats for Sold-Out Performances
To ensure that you get tickets to your favorite Christmas concert or stage show, especially if the event is sold-out, follow these steps.
- Verify the official ticket vendor website and box office information to purchase tickets securely. Look out for official ticket websites and the ticket vendor’s phone number.
- Create an online account to expedite the ticket-buying process and ensure easier seat selection in the future.
- Sign up for the event’s email newsletter to stay updated about last-minute cancellations or ticket availability.
- Explore secondary ticketing websites as a last resort, but ensure to verify the authenticity and safety of these websites before making any online transactions.
- Consider alternative days or times for sold-out performances. Some events offer additional showings or matinee performances.
- Don’t forget to reserve your seats as soon as possible. This reduces the risk of your tickets being canceled or sold to another customer.
